Australian Menswear: A Look Guide

Australian bloke's attire embodies a relaxed feel born from a unique blend of surf culture, rugged practicality, and a laid-back approach to presentation. Think classic denim jeans , well-worn hide boots, and comfortable breathable shirts – often in muted tones or featuring subtle prints. A key element is functionality; you’ll find robust fabrics and useful designs geared towards an adventurous lifestyle. Whether you’re heading to the beach or exploring the bush , this introduction will help you grasp the core principles of Australian look and build a versatile wardrobe.

Must-Have Items for the Australian Guy's Wardrobe

Building a well-rounded wardrobe for the Australian man requires a mix of classic pieces. Think reliable denim jeans, a crisp cotton shirt, and a stylish polo shirt for casual days. Don't forget a cozy linen short or chinos, perfect for the warm weather. A tailored jacket, be it a lightweight blazer or a classic denim coat, adds versatility. Finally, invest in a pair of hard-wearing boots and neutral sneakers to cover all occasions. Consider adding a few well-chosen accessories like a stylish hat or a quality belt to complete the look.
